Filed for security review visibility. The TaxPerch service caches jurisdiction tax rates for the Orvale checkout platform. During the quarterly audit we found the production cache TTL and eviction settings no longer match what's in source control — someone applied a hotfix directly during the Belmont region incident and never backported it. Risk: stale rates could be served past the intended freshness window. No evidence of tampering; this looks like ordinary drift. The live values observed in production are captured below.

deployment values, kajep-kageg:
[praix]
host = praix.paliqcorp.corp
user = praix_svc
database = praix_prod

Alert: sustained heap growth in the Thumbnailer image cache on the Driftwood media service. Evicted entries are not releasing their decoded bitmap buffers, causing roughly 40 MB/hour of retained memory per worker until OOM restarts occur. Future maintainers: do not simply raise the memory limit; the leak is in the eviction callback. Diagnosis steps and the heap-dump procedure are documented on the internal page below.

operations page: https://confluence.qorvellabs.internal/pages/projects/projects/projects

Document Transport — Quarterly Stock-Count Ledger (Receiving Site Guide). The bound ledger from the Narrowfield depot travels in the grey tamper-evident pouch and must be signed in within ten minutes of arrival. Do not photocopy before the count reconciliation is complete. Because the ledger is audit-sensitive, the courier hand-over follows the instruction stated below.

courier memo of yawep-yafog: the pramir ulaix courier leaves the ulavan aldix frair zorok oliiel joreth rusdor fenvan ledger at gate 1305 under passcode 514738

# Approvals — TilePloy Map-Tile Prefetcher

TilePloy prefetches map tiles for the Wayfarer app based on predicted routes. Any change to prefetch radius, cache eviction, or upstream tile quotas requires written approval, since misconfiguration can exhaust bandwidth budgets overnight. Submit changes through the standard review queue and obtain sign-off from the responsible maintainer named below.

signatory, tageg-hahof: Ralion Kelion Fraael